WebFeb 28, 2024 · Irish soda bread is prepared without yeast. Traditionally it has just four ingredients: flour, baking soda, salt, and buttermilk. The baking soda and buttermilk react … WebMar 6, 2024 · Irish Soda Bread is a quick bread recipe that uses baking soda for leavening rather than yeast. Traditionally Irish Soda Bread is made up of 4 ingredients: Flour Baking soda Salt Buttermilk Technically raisins aren’t included, but I’ve always eaten my small batch Irish soda bread with raisins.
